1. Understanding Refrigerator Configurations

Before limiting your list by brand name or color, Compare Fridge Freezers you should decide which setup fits your cooking area design and way of life. Here are the most common styles readily available on the market today:

  • Top-Freezer Refrigerators: The traditional design. These are normally the most energy-efficient and affordable. They are perfect for smaller sized kitchens or garages.
  • Bottom-Freezer Refrigerators: Placing the fridge at eye level makes good sense considering that you use it regularly than the freezer. These models are popular for ergonomic accessibility.
  • Side-by-Side Refrigerators: These split the fridge and freezer vertically. They are great if you have a narrow kitchen area pathway and require fast access to both frozen and fresh goods.
  • French Door Refrigerators: The existing gold requirement. These include 2 doors for the fridge on the top and a pull-out freezer drawer listed below. They offer a broad storage space that can quickly accommodate big plates.
  • Counter-Depth Refrigerators: Designed to sit flush with your kitchen cabinetry, these offer a sleek, integrated appearance, though they normally compromise a little bit of interior depth.

3. Secret Factors to Evaluate Before You Buy

Measuring Your Space

Nothing is more discouraging than having a new Fridge Freezer Retailers provided just to find it does not fit through the door or leaves no space for the doors to swing open.

  • Step the Height, Width, and Depth: Remember to represent the hinge clearance.
  • Step the Path: Ensure the unit can fit through hallways and entrances leading to the kitchen area.
  • Consider Clearance: Always leave a minimum of one to two inches of space around the sides and back for correct airflow, which prevents the compressor from overheating.

Energy Efficiency

Refrigerators are the only appliance in your home that never ever takes a break. Search for the Energy Star label. An Energy Star-certified fridge can save you substantial cash on your electricity bill over its lifespan.

Storage and Organization

Consider how you store. Do you purchase wholesale? A model with adjustable racks, gallon-sized door bins, and humidity-controlled crisper drawers is essential. 4. Notable Features to Look For

Modern Buy Fridges are loaded with innovation developed to extend the life of your food. While these functions increase the rate, they likewise include enormous value.

  1. Double Cooling Systems: Separates the air flow in the fridge and freezer. This avoids smells from migrating and keeps the humidity levels ideal for fresh fruit and vegetables.
  2. Smart Connectivity: Built-in Wi-Fi permits you to track expiration dates, see the within your fridge by means of a smartphone app while at the supermarket, and even get maintenance informs.
  3. Water and Ice Filtration: While convenient, keep in mind that these need regular filter replacements. Guarantee the filter lies in an accessible area.
  4. Versatile Zones: Some high-end models offer a “flex drawer”– a middle drawer that can be adapted to different temperatures, ideal for changing in between a white wine chiller, a treat bin, or extra freezer space.

5. Maintenance Tips for Longevity

Purchasing an excellent fridge is only step one. Where To Buy Fridge ensure it runs efficiently for years, follow these maintenance suggestions:

  • Clean the Condenser Coils: Dust buildup on the coils requires the motor to work more difficult. Vacuum the coils behind or below your fridge a minimum of when a year.
  • Examine the Door Gaskets: If the rubber seals are split or loose, cold air escapes, forcing the compressor to run continuously. Keep them clean and change them if they lose their suction.
  • Don’t Overstock: While it’s tempting to pack the fridge, air flow is important for cooling. Overcrowding can lead to warm areas and ruined food.
  • Modification Filters Regularly: If your fridge has a water dispenser, alter the filter every six months to ensure high water quality and prevent scale accumulation in the lines.

Regularly Asked Questions (FAQ)

Q: How long should I expect my fridge to last?A: With appropriate maintenance, a top quality refrigerator normally lasts in between 10 to 15 years.

Q: Is it worth paying additional for a “Smart” fridge?A: It depends on your lifestyle. If you delight in technology and want functions like stock management and remote monitoring, it deserves it. If you prefer a simpler experience, a premium “dumb” fridge will carry out the cooling functions simply as well.

Q: How much area do I require behind the fridge for ventilation?A: Most makers advise a minimum of one inch of clearance on the sides and top, and two inches in the back, though this can vary by model. Always inspect the particular owner’s manual.

Q: Why is my fridge making a loud sound?A: Some noise is typical (like the clicking of the ice maker or the hum of the compressor). Nevertheless, if you hear a grinding or rattling sound, it may indicate a malfunctioning fan or particles captured in the coils.

Q: Should I choose stainless steel or another surface?A: Stainless steel is the market requirement for a clean, contemporary look, but it can reveal fingerprints. If you have a hectic home, look for “PrintProof” or “Fingerprint-resistant” stainless steel, or think about black stainless or slate surfaces.
